Output 2ec70514389f8675c4b96ba22b5c6eaca085e1884040f1566abbf49ec8066c43:1

value
1020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eb379abafdc15ae1b5949cf0599a77a35b03ed1 OP_EQUAL
address
3BnMFohGroVRSdMkdjFT97Mjxfap3PcYtg
transaction
2ec70514389f8675c4b96ba22b5c6eaca085e1884040f1566abbf49ec8066c43
spent
true